The VCX Forum has published updated versions of two important Forum documents: the VCX Lab Authority (v4.0) and the VCX Sponsors Handbook (v3.9).
Both documents have been reviewed and updated to reflect the Forum’s current operating structure, recent Board discussions, and the practical needs of laboratories, sponsors, members, and prospective participants.
In addition, the Board has approved a 5% adjustment to the annual VCX membership fee. The revised fee supports the continued operation and development of VCX programmes, documentation, laboratory activities, and member services.
VCX Lab Authority
The updated VCX Lab Authority defines how laboratories participate in the VCX ecosystem and how testing responsibilities are managed within the Forum.
Version 3.9 improves the presentation of the laboratory framework, including the distinction between VCX Trusted Labs and VCX Forum Certified Labs, the handling of test results, publication responsibilities, data verification, and the relationship between laboratories and the Forum.
The revision also improves document structure, terminology, and consistency, making the document easier to use as a reference for future laboratory activities.
VCX Sponsors Handbook
The updated VCX Sponsors Handbook provides the current reference for organisations supporting the VCX Forum through sponsorship.
The new version clarifies the sponsorship structure, sponsor participation, declaration requirements, visibility within VCX activities, and the general conditions under which sponsorship benefits are provided.
The handbook has also been revised to improve readability and consistency with the Forum’s current communication and operational practices.
Membership Fee Revision
The annual VCX membership fee has been adjusted by 5% following Board approval.
This adjustment reflects the continued growth of Forum activities and helps support the work required to maintain VCX evaluation programmes, technical documentation, laboratory coordination, member support, and related administrative services.
